The latter is a formal device, one that occurs when the … Visa mer ‘The Raven’ by Edgar Allan Poe is a ballad made up of eighteen six-line stanzas. Throughout, the poet uses trochaic octameter, a very distinctive metrical form. The poem … WebbThe Raven: The selected stanza from "The Raven" is key to understanding the work because it represents the culmination of the speaker's descent into despair and the permanence of his grief. The raven's continued presence, its eyes resembling a demon's, symbolizes the speaker's inability to escape the shadow of his sorrow.
